We want to collect rainfall samples to establish a local meteoric water line using stable isotope ratios (δD and δO18). We've built our own rainfall totalizers and bottles will be switched on a monthly basis. What is the best way to clean collection bottles as well as other components of the rainfall totalizers if they will be re-used? Is washing with distilled water and air-drying adequate?
